Where reliable IT ends and defensible security begins
A pipeline for accountability—not just activity
Healthy operations deserve credit: they keep people working. Cybersecurity and compliance, though, answer a different question—whether you can show, under scrutiny, how you protect data, who owns each control, and that your tooling still matches the environment you run today. Those answers rarely emerge from ticket volume alone; they come from intention, documentation, and rhythm. The path below is how we help you build that depth before renewal, audit, or incident forces the conversation.
- 01
Clarify what actually applies to you
We begin with your real obligations: contracts, regulatory frameworks, and the insurer questionnaires you will actually sign—not a one-size-fits-all maturity chart. HIPAA, PCI, CMMC, SOC 2–style programs, state privacy rules, and carrier attestations only help when mapped to your stack; otherwise you invest in theater while the real gaps stay invisible.
- 02
Tie controls to evidence worth keeping
A resolved ticket shows work happened; it does not always prove a control is alive. We connect what auditors and underwriters expect to durable artifacts—logging and retention, configuration intent, scan history, policy owners—so proof accumulates through ordinary work instead of frantic reconstruction when someone asks hard questions.
- 03
Align operations with what you claim
Monitoring, identity, backups, patching, and response matter when they match the story you tell leadership and your carrier. We help implement and govern that operating layer, then translate it into language non-specialists can follow—faithful to how your systems behave when reviewed, not how they read on a slide.
- 04
Keep readiness ordinary, not heroic
The goal is not a single heroic sprint before renewal. We maintain a steady cadence of reviews, compliance-oriented scans, and concise executive summaries so evidence stays current—so audits, renewals, and urgent calls find you with context already in hand, calm and coherent.
The most persuasive security story is the one your logs, owners, and history already tell—when someone finally asks.
